Hiccup Horrendous Haddock III has always been different, and the fact that he was born deaf just made things even worse. Unfortunately, turning sixteen brought even more changes to his life, like being removed as his dad’s heir and arranged in marriage to none other than Ruffnut Thorston. At least he had made a new friend to help him through everything, though the village would brand him a traitor if they ever found out.
As he becomes closer with his new dragon friend, he realizes that he can no longer stay on Berk. There’s too much at risk and there’s something out there, something that only he and Toothless can resolve. So he leaves, along with his new wife, to make peace for the dragons and save them from a tyrant.
Years go by, and Berk has been left in the past…until they show up on the shores of the island they call home. What are they supposed to do now?

Seungcheol has spent his entire life in a cloistered cult, molded into the perfect, obedient husband for their dreaded patron demon. On his wedding night, he’s sacrificed in a grand blood ritual meant to summon the Lord of Shadows himself.
The ritual works — except it doesn’t.
Instead, Jeonghan appears: an infuriatingly beautiful demon with a wicked grin, an aversion to seriousness, and a deeply concerning willingness to set people on fire for fun. The cult is horrified. Jeonghan is thrilled. And Seungcheol… really just wants to understand why his new husband keeps trying to feed him grapes in the middle of mortal danger.
Unfortunately for everyone, Jeonghan hasn’t had a partner in centuries — and now that he’s been given one, he’s keeping him. Which means Seungcheol is about to learn that the only thing more dangerous than marrying a demon… is being loved by one.
